Prop. 69 DNA Samples Lead to Two Arrests

From Times Staff Reports

DNA samples collected as a result of last year’s passage of Proposition 69 have resulted in the first arrests in the county.

Blood left on a tool at a Victorville car dealership where 10 cars were burglarized led to the arrest of Ian James Thomas, who had been detained in an Orange County case in January.

Additionally, saliva inside a ski mask recovered after a Victorville bank robbery in August 2003 links Jimmy Del Willis to the crime, authorities alleged. Willis was arrested on suspicion of robbery in Apple Valley in January, sheriff’s officials said.
